CrowdFundMe successor Entera starts exit from Next Geosolutions stake, expects about EUR 1 million proceeds
Reuters2026/08/03 12:50- CrowdFundMe-led Entera started an exit from its indirect stake in Next Geosolutions via liquidation of holding vehicles.
- Cash proceeds attributable to Entera estimated at about EUR 1 million, largely already collected.
- Transaction generated an estimated return of about 2x on invested capital.
- Entera holds 8.93% of Smart4Sea, which owns 50% of SmartVSL Geosolutions, the vehicle that held the NextGeo stake.
- Proceeds earmarked to fund Entera’s growth, including M&A.
